The Critical Role of Materials – Meeting our Energy & Material Services within Planetary Boundaries
Abstract
Materials play a key role in the transition to a sustainable society. The production of materials is responsible for over a quarter of global greenhouse gas emissions, and yet we need (new) materials as part of the energy transition to a sustainable energy system. Material efficiency and circularity are to play a key role in the transition if we want to stay within planetary boundaries. The transition to a circular economy and society requires a new relationship between materials and our society, from the making of materials, the design of materials and products, consumption and end of life. The presentation will explore the multiple dimensions of materials within the transition to a sustainable society.
